Title: The Innovative Contributions of Gisbert Wolfgang Kaefer
Introduction
Gisbert Wolfgang Kaefer, hailing from Birmenstorf, Switzerland, is a notable inventor with a remarkable portfolio of four patents. With a strong background in engineering, he has focused on advancing technologies in the energy sector, particularly in gas turbines and carbon capture systems. His innovative solutions have the potential to significantly impact environmental sustainability.
Latest Patents
Among his latest inventions is a sophisticated power plant design that incorporates a gas turbine unit capable of efficiently feeding flue gases into a boiler of a steam turbine unit. This system enables a recirculated flow of gases, where the recirculated mixture, combined with fresh air, enhances the efficiency of the gas turbine unit compressor. Moreover, the discharged flow is directed into a carbon dioxide capture unit, which utilizes either an amine-based or chilled ammonia-based method for effective carbon capture. A novel feature of this invention includes a shower cooler that pre-treats flue gases before they reach the CO2 capture unit. Another significant patent focuses on a flue gas stream processing system, which involves a fuel reactor that combusts fuel to produce a flue gas stream rich in water vapor, carbon monoxide, and carbon dioxide. This system is enhanced by an oxidation catalyst that converts carbon monoxide into a carbon dioxide-rich flue gas stream, which is then liquefied in a processing unit to generate exhaust gas.
Career Highlights
Gisbert currently works at Alstom Technology Limited, a company renowned for its pioneering contributions to the energy sector. His work at Alstom includes developing innovative solutions that enhance the efficiency and environmental performance of energy systems.
Collaborations
Throughout his career, Kaefer has collaborated with esteemed colleagues such as Michal Tadeusz Bialkowski and Eribert Benz. These partnerships have fostered a creative environment that propels innovative ideas into practical applications within the industry.
